The livery of the Suzuki GSX-RR does not change for 2021, except for the big news represented by the Monster Energy scratch that appears for the first time on the beasts of Hamamatsu. The bikes of Joan Mir and Alex Rins have in fact been made more aggressive by the presence of the new sponsor, which occupies a very important portion of the fairings of the Japanese bikes. 

The colour scheme is very attractive, echoing the Suzuki centenary colour scheme used last season, and gives a very sleek look to a bike that has very balanced volumes, especially when compared to other bikes on the grid that feature very distinctive lines and shapes.
